Sometimes a pregnancy or birth might not go as planned and there are
many stresses associated with an early or difficult birth. For these
babies and families there is a special place to receive the additional
care they need and the extra support to get through this challenging
time. The Family Birth Center at Marin General includes a Level II
Neonatal Intensive Care Unit (NICU), located on the Fourth Floor,
Central Wing, near the Family Birth Center.

MGH's Neonatal Intensive Care Unit, the only one in Marin County, is
fully equipped for the specialized care of infants needing extra medical
attention. The NICU supports the needs of babies and is fully staffed
round the clock by nurses certified in neonatology. Marin General
Hospital provides in-house pediatric hospitalist who specialize in the
care of sick newborns. The care team also collaborates with the infant's
private physician as well as the Neonatology team at UCSF.
The unit recently welcomed new beds for its tiny patients. The NICU also
has specialized equipment, including isolettes, ventilators, intravenous
pumps, radiant warmers and pulse oximeters. Services include advanced
respiratory therapy, developmental care, phototherapy, daily nutrition
consultation, access to an NICU pharmacists, lactation assistance and
family support.
The staff and physicians at the NICU look after babies as well as their
families, respecting and nurturing the bond between them during the child's path
to recovery.
